Program Description

The Registered Insurance Brokers of Ontario (RIBO) is the self-regulatory body for insurance brokers in Ontario. Established in October 1981, RIBO regulates the licensing, professional competence, ethical conduct and insurance related obligations of all independent general insurance brokers in the province.

Every registered insurance broker must be properly licensed and the first step is to complete the Entry Level RIBO licensing examination which requires a minimum passing grade of 75%. Individuals who pass the exam are eligible to work in the industry with the restriction of "Acting Under Supervision". For the complete licensing details please visit www.ribo.com.

Durham Colleges offers a prep course to prepare you to write the RIBO exam and is based on the content / material covered during the exam. Upon completing the course you will write the RIBO licensing exam.
